Dell U2713HM. Runs at full 2560 x 1440 with mini display port to display port cable. HDMI will run at 1920 x 1200.

My setup is using mini DP to DP for extending my iMac to the Dell monitor. A separate HDMI runs from my xbox360 to my Dell monitor.
